Бета версіяЗалишити відгук

Практика до досконалості: трейдинг‑симулятори та бектестинг

Практика до досконалості: трейдинг‑симулятори та бектестинг

У спорті, музиці чи авіації ніхто не чекає майстерності без сотень годин тренувань. У трейдингу ж багато хто відразу кидає в ринок реальні гроші, навіть не перевіривши ідеї в трейдинг‑симуляторі чи через бектестинг.

Якщо ви хочете торгувати на рівні професіонала, вам потрібне середовище для безпечної практики. Саме для цього існують day trading simulator та системний бектестинг — вони дозволяють відточувати сетапи й поведінку без постійної плати ринку за помилки.

У цьому гіді розберемо, як перетворити симуляцію та бектестинг на справжній edge, а не просто «гру на демо».

Що таке трейдинг‑симулятор

Трейдинг‑симулятор — це інструмент, який дозволяє відкривати й закривати угоди в умовному середовищі (з реальними або історичними котируваннями), не ризикуючи реальними грошима.

Основні типи:

  • Live demo — паперові рахунки від брокерів, де угоди йдуть у реальному часі;
  • Replay‑симулятори — програвачі історичних даних, де ви «прокручуєте» ринок, як відео (часто з прискоренням);
  • Сценарні симулятори — готові сценарії ринку для відпрацювання конкретних ситуацій.

Для інтрадей‑трейдингу особливо корисний саме day trading simulator: ви можете «прожити» багато торгових днів за одну реальну сесію й отримати десятки повторень одного й того самого сетапу.

Що таке бектестинг

Бектестинг — це перевірка торгової системи на історичних даних з метою побачити, як вона поводилася б у минулому.

Форми бектестингу:

  • ручний — ви промотуєте графік, відмічаєте умовні входи/виходи, записуєте результат;
  • напівавтоматичний — частину вимірювань робить софт, але входи/виходи ви все одно визначаєте вручну;
  • повністю автоматичний — код проганяє стратегію по історії й віддає повну статистику.

Day trading simulator тренує виконання в реальному часі, а бектестинг дає статистичне розуміння правил і edge на великій вибірці.

Навіщо потрібні симулятори та бектестинг

Якщо використовувати їх правильно, трейдинг‑симулятор і бектестинг дозволяють:

  • перевіряти ідеї без ризику — відсіювати «сирі» концепції до виходу в live;
  • точно налаштовувати входи/виходи — бачити, як дрібні зміни правил впливають на розподіл R;
  • тренувати виконання — відпрацьовувати постановку ордерів, дотримання стопів і денних лімітів;
  • будувати впевненість — опиратись на статистику, а не інтуїцію.

Якщо ж використовувати «для розваги», day trading simulator легко перетворюється на відеогру, яка формує погані звички.

Як правильно використовувати day trading simulator

Справжня сила day trading simulator розкривається, коли ви ставитесь до нього як пілот до авіасимулятора — а не як до аркадної гри.

1. Почніть із чіткого плейбуку

До старту роботи в симуляторі визначте:

  • які ринки торгуєте (1–3 основні інструменти);
  • які таймфрейми використовуєте (наприклад, M1–M5 для скальпінгу, M5–M15 для інтрадей‑свінгу);
  • 2–3 основні сетапи з прописаними правилами входу, стопа й take profit.

Без плейбуку симулятор просто збільшує кількість випадкових дій.

2. Ставтесь до симуляції як до реальної сесії

На кожну сесію в day trading simulator задайте:

  • чіткий торговий час (початок/кінець), як у реальному дні;
  • фіксований ризик на угоду (в R) і денний стоп;
  • обов’язкове логування всіх угод у журнал.

Запитуйте себе перед угодою: «Якби це були реальні гроші, я б усе одно зайшов?» Якщо ні — не заходьте й у симуляторі.

3. Фокус на якості, а не кількості

Ціль — не відкривати по 100 угод за сесію в day trading simulator. Ціль:

  • торгувати лише свої сетапи;
  • ідеально дотримуватись стопів і ліміту втрат;
  • не піддаватись FOMO та revenge навіть у «паперовому» режимі.

Саме тут формується м’язова пам’ять правильної поведінки.

Покроковий підхід до бектестингу

1. Пропишіть правила максимально чітко

Перед бектестингом ваші правила мають бути придатними до повторення:

  • фільтр тренду (MA, структура максимумів/мінімумів тощо);
  • умови входу (патерн, рівні, підтвердження);
  • стоп‑лосс (де інвалідейшн і як саме ставите стоп);
  • логіка take profit (фіксоване R, рівні, трейлінг);
  • часові фільтри (сесії, заборона торгівлі під час новин тощо).

Якщо двоє людей за цими правилами отримують зовсім різні угоди — правила ще сирі.

2. Оберіть репрезентативний період історії

Для чесного бектестингу потрібні дані, які включають:

  • різні фазі ринку — тренди, флєти, високу й низьку волатильність;
  • достатню кількість угод (прагніть до 50–100+ трейдів на сетап).

3. Записуйте детальну статистику

Для кожної умовної угоди в бектестингу фіксуйте хоча б:

  • дату й інструмент;
  • тип сетапу;
  • entry, stop, target, фактичний вихід;
  • результат у R;
  • контекст (тренд, сесія, волатильність).

4. Аналізуйте очікування й розподіл результатів

Після того, як набрали достатню вибірку, порахуйте:

  • winrate;
  • середній профіт і середній лос у R;
  • expectancy (очікування в R на угоду);
  • максимальну просадку у R й максимальну серію лосів;
  • результат по сетапах, сесіях, умовах ринку.

Це показує не тільки, «чи працює» система, а й як саме вона поводиться.

Типові помилки з симуляторами та бектестингом

1. «Гратися» на демо як у відеогру

Без правил day trading simulator швидко привчає до:

  • оверторгівлі;
  • ігнорування ризику;
  • FOMO‑входів «бо рухається».

2. Перефітування (curve‑fitting) у бектесті

Коли ви підганяєте параметри під історію (MA 17.5, точні хвилини входу тощо), можете отримати ідеальний бектест і жахливу реальність.

3. Ігнорування виконання та проскальзування

Багато бектестів і симуляторів припускають ідеальні входи/виходи. У реальному ринку є:

  • спреди й проскальзування;
  • неповні заповнення;
  • швидкі рухи на новинах.

Профі або закладають це в моделі, або принаймні тримають у голові, що реальний результат буде гіршим за «лабораторний».

4. «Застрягти» в симуляторі назавжди

Симулятор і бектестинг — це тренажер, а не постійне місце проживання. У якийсь момент потрібно:

  • перейти до малого реального лоту;
  • зіткнутись із реальними емоціями грошей;
  • продовжувати вести журнал і покращувати систему вже на live‑даних.

Як поєднати бектестинг, day trading simulator і live‑торгівлю

Одна з робочих схем розвитку:

  1. Ідея + правила — прописати стратегію у вигляді чітких правил;
  2. Бектестинг — перевірити правила на історичних даних, оцінити edge;
  3. Day trading simulator — відпрацювати виконання в режимі «майже live»;
  4. Live з мінімальним ризиком — перейти на реальні гроші з крихітним обсягом;
  5. Review та ітерації — порівнювати live із сим/бектестом, коригувати правила.

30‑денний план побудови практики

  1. Дні 1–3: написати плейбук (ринок, таймфрейм, 2–3 сетапи, ризик‑правила);
  2. Дні 4–10: зробити ручний бектест 20–30 угод по одному ключовому сетапу;
  3. Дні 11–20: провести 5–10 повноцінних сесій у day trading simulator, торгуючи тільки цей сетап;
  4. Дні 21–25: проаналізувати всю статистику (з бектесту й симулятора) — winrate, expectancy, просадку;
  5. Дні 26–30: почати торгувати на реальних грошах з мінімальним R, продовжуючи журналити та порівнювати з сим/бектестом.

Висновок: тренуватись із сенсом, а не «на відчуттях»

Самі по собі трейдинг‑симулятори й бектестинг не зроблять вас профі. Але якщо поєднати їх з чітким плейбуком, R‑орієнтованим ризик‑менеджментом і чесним журналом угод, вони стають середовищем, де ви можете тренуватися до досконалості без зливів.

Ставтесь до симулятора й бектестингу так само серйозно, як до live‑торгівлі, — і з часом різниця між тим, як ви торгуєте на day trading simulator, і тим, як торгуєте реальними грошима, майже зникне. А разом із цим з’явиться саме те, заради чого потрібна практика: стабільний, перевірений edge.

Практика до досконалості: трейдинг‑симулятори та бектестинг | TradeTrack Blog | TradeTrack